Journal of Biological Sciences1727-30481812-5719Asian Network for Scientific Information10.3923/jbs.2008.1149.1157A. Al-OmairMohammed M. YoussefMagdy 7200887The present study was designed to investigate the effect
of selenium (Se) administration (as sodium selenite: 0.5 or 1 mg kg-1
body weight) or/and α-difluromethylornithine (DFMO: 2 mg kg-1
body weight) on the elevated polyamine levels. For this purpose the polyamine
(putrescine, spermidine, spermine) levels were elevated in female Swiss
albino mice by adding 2% of both L-arginine and L-ornithine to the drinking
water for four weeks. The elevated putrescine and spermidine levels were
decreased significantly by administration low and high dose of Se. The
DFMO abolished the concentrations of both putrescine and spermidine in
liver and kidney of the experimental mice. The combination of Se and DFMO
normalized the polyamine levels. On the other hand, the spermine level
was increased in liver and kidney by administration of Se or/and DFMO.
To elucidate the effects of the elevated polyamines on the oxidative enzymes,
the activity of glutathione peroxidase (GSH-PX), glutathione reductase
(GSH-R) and superoxide dismutase (SOD) in the liver and the kidneys of
the experimental mice were determined. The GSH-Px, GSH-R and SOD activities
were increased by Se administration compared to the control. Conversely,
DFMO produced an inhibition in the activity of antioxidative enzymes.
These results suggest that the combination between Se and DFMO appear
to be additive chemopreventive effect to reduce the elevated polyamine
levels. This combination will protect the tissues from the deleterious
effect of high polyamine levels and improve the activities of the cellular
antioxidative system.]]>Ackermann, J.M., A.E. Pegg and D.E. McCloskey,20035461468Bagni, N. and A. Tassoni,200120301317Battell, M.L., H.L. Delgataty and J.H. McNeill,19981792734Belle, N.A., G.D.
